A Ford E-150 exhaust system diagram provides a visual representation of the components that make up the exhaust system of a Ford E-150 van. This system is responsible for removing exhaust gases from the engine and directing them out of the vehicle. The diagram can be helpful for understanding how the system works, troubleshooting problems, or making repairs.

The exhaust system on a Ford E-150 typically consists of an exhaust manifold, catalytic converter, muffler, resonator, and tailpipe. The exhaust manifold is connected to the engine and collects the exhaust gases. The catalytic converter helps to reduce emissions by converting harmful pollutants into less harmful substances. The muffler helps to reduce the noise level of the exhaust gases. The resonator helps to reduce the amount of vibration in the exhaust system. The tailpipe directs the exhaust gases out of the vehicle.

2. Layout

The layout of the Ford E-150 exhaust system is important for ensuring that the system functions properly and efficiently. The diagram provides a clear visual representation of how the components are connected to each other and how they are routed through the vehicle.

  • Component Connectivity: The diagram shows how the different components of the exhaust system are connected to each other. This is important for understanding how the system works as a whole and for troubleshooting problems.
  • Routing: The diagram shows how the exhaust gases are routed through the vehicle. This is important for ensuring that the gases are directed away from the vehicle’s occupants and that the system does not create excessive noise or vibration.
  • Efficiency: The layout of the exhaust system can affect the efficiency of the system. A well-designed system will route the exhaust gases in a way that minimizes backpressure and maximizes the flow of gases.
  • Maintenance: The layout of the exhaust system can also affect the ease of maintenance. A well-designed system will make it easy to access the components for inspection and repair.

Overall, the layout of the Ford E-150 exhaust system is an important factor in the system’s performance and functionality. The diagram provides a valuable tool for understanding the layout of the system and for troubleshooting problems.
